Tamiya Tourers B Final: Foxwell Dominates from Start to Finish
What a drive from Ian Foxwell in the Tamiya Tourers B Final tonight at Sevenoaks Model Car Club! From the moment the tone dropped, Foxwell was in a class of his own, leading every single lap of the 21-lap race. He set the fastest lap of the race with a blistering 13.98 seconds and maintained a comfortable gap to second place throughout. A truly commanding performance to take the win.
Behind the dominant leader, Martin Timms secured a strong second position. He held second place for the entire race, completing 20 laps. Oscar Pay came home in third, also completing 20 laps but finishing just behind Timms. Pay spent the early laps of the race fighting for position before settling into third, which he held from lap 3 onwards.
Further down the order, Donna Belton-Timms fought back valiantly after an early struggle, moving up through the field to finish fourth. Polly Gammage held onto fifth place for much of the race, eventually completing 15 laps. Peter McKerrow rounded out the finishers in sixth, after completing 13 laps.
